Montréal sauvage

2023

This documentary lifts the veil on the secret lives of rare and little-known animals hiding in the last remaining wild spaces on the island of Montréal, home to over 2 million people. Through the city’s picturesque landscapes and striking footage of Canadian wildlife, “Montréal sauvage” paints a portrait of a select few discreet species that have managed to carve out a thriving niche alongside humans, capitalizing on undesirable urban areas to flourish undetected.
